Block

#21,721,860
Block Number
21,721,860 @ 05/20/2025, 13:30:00
Status
Finalized
ID
0x014b730497547cb694c4bece00e6b57d43714139fc8ad2bed39d073d8fc59b8d
Transactions
Gas Used
3628172/39999962 (9.07% Used)
Total Score
2,121,404,171 (+98)
Rewards
14.56 VTHO